#036a48 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#036a48 is composed of 1.2% red, 41.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 160.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 21.4%. #036a48 color hex could be obtained by blending #06d490 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#036a48

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b07 is the darkest color, while #f7fff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#036a48

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353837 is the less saturated color, while #036a48 is the most saturated one.
